MAN JAILED FOR ALLEGED CRIMINAL MISCHIEF INCIDENT SUNDAY

February 23, 2021 10:00 a.m.

A Roseburg man was jailed for an alleged criminal mischief incident, by Roseburg Police on Sunday.

A report from Roseburg Police said about 8:20 p.m. 25-year old Alek Caporale allegedly destroyed several items in the apartment of a family member in the 3000 block of West Godeck. The man also reportedly broke a window in the residence and several of the broken items into a parking lot. The report said his behavior caused a great deal of alarm.

The report said the man had allegedly not slept in a few days, due to methamphetamine use. He was charged with second degree counts of disorderly conduct and criminal mischief and for offensive littering.

Caporale was detained on $10,000 bail.
